The Prof. Sehoon Park group (Chemistry Program) is looking for 2 PhD/Master students to conduct research projects in the field of synthetic and organometallic chemistry, which particularly involved in transition metal-catalyzed C-H functionalizations and unique olefin polymerizations.
The Park group will drive a research direction toward discovery of new reactivity to molecules in catalysis, which will be guided on the basis of synthetic and mechanistic organometallic chemistry. The Park group’s research goal is to develop efficient catalytic systems for selective transformations of naturally abundant, but inert molecules including simple (hetero)aromatics, alkanes, and alkenes to provide new synthetic (chiral) intermediates for pharmaceuticals and natural products, and unique polymeric materials.
(I) Our primary research goal is to enable non-precious metal-catalyzed oxidative C-H functionalizations of alkanes and reductive functionalizations of (hetero)arenes by using organosilicon and boron reagents.
(II) The second research program is to synthesize unique structures of polymers via coordination polymerization followed by post-modification, and to systematically study the relationship between the structure of repeating units and the polymer’s physical/rheological properties in close collaborations with material scientists.
